What are noemata?

In alterhuman communities, the term "noemata" (singular noema) refers to inherent knowledge about one's identity. The exact experiences encompassed by "noemata" as a term are intentionally left vague and open to interpretation, but in my personal experience it would be best described as "just knowing" things about my Raidou-ness. Noemata in relation to my Raidou-ness

Since my Raidou-ness contains both aspects of me-as-Raidou and Raidou-as-fictional-character, the line between "headcanon" and "noema" can be a bit fuzzy. While I do have some headcanons that I consider exclusively as such, they're mostly for fun and exist as a way for me to explore "what if" scenarios involving Raidou-as-fictional-character that I can "turn off" whenever I want. Otherwise, I consider my headcanons and my noemata to be one and the same. They are immutable beliefs that I hold about my Raidou-ness, stemming from both my perception of me-as-Raidou and the way I interpret Raidou-as-fictional-character. I know that mixing fictional identity and fandom is generally frowned upon in fictionfolk spaces, but as someone with alexithymia I find that fandom can be a very helpful tool for introspection. By using the framework of fandom activities such as roleplaying or discussing headcanons to explore my Raidou-ness, I can find the shape of my identity in the contours of how I speak about my source or what are certain sticking points for me much more easily than trying to turn inwards and look for guidance in emotions that I can barely comprehend.
